#c4b999 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4b999 is composed of 76.9% red, 72.5%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 44.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.7% and a lightness of 68.4%. #c4b999 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#897333.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#c4b999 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c4b999 has RGB values of R:196, G:185,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.22,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12892569.

Hex triplet c4b999 #c4b999
RGB Decimal 196, 185, 153 rgb(196,185,153)
RGB Percent 76.9, 72.5, 60 rgb(76.9%,72.5%,60%)
CMYK 0, 6, 22, 23
HSL 44.7°, 26.7, 68.4 hsl(44.7,26.7%,68.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 44.7°, 21.9, 76.9
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 75.286, -1.3, 17.666
XYZ 45.863, 48.734, 37.126
xyY 0.348, 0.37, 48.734
CIE-LCH 75.286, 17.713, 94.208
CIE-LUV 75.286, 8.506, 24.909
Hunter-Lab 69.81, -4.899, 17.336
Binary 11000100, 10111001, 10011001

Shades and Tints of #c4b999

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0906 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
